I did a little bit of digging a couple of days ago when I first saw that article.

TP has gutted their partner awards with massive and unannounced devaluations in the past few years. Nevertheless, based on my research, the only decent points redemption for Ozzie’s is one-way to/from USA in Business with Emirates for 130K. And they don’t pass on fuel surcharges like Qantas does. I got excited when I discovered this, until I read further on FT that Emirates has been blocking long haul business awards to TP for a few years now.

There are some good business redemptions elsewhere, but not cracking deals. TP seems to be paying for the lowest level awards (ala Lifemiles) hence very limited availability with the decent Star Alliance carriers and destinations you want to fly to.

I didn’t look into the Star Alliance Gold status as this doesn’t interest me that much.

On the surface it seems like a great deal. But I just don’t trust TP, their booking engine, their customer service and more importantly the lack of award availability (which btw you can’t check until you have miles in your account) to take the plunge. If any anyone else does, please keep us abreast of your efforts.
